Blaze Pizza in Conway, Arkansas, offers a vibrant and fast-casual pizza experience that puts you in control of your meal with their signature Build Your Own Pizza option. Whether you're craving a classic cheesy slice or a bold, inventive creation, Blaze Pizza’s menu caters to all appetites with an impressive variety of toppings – including the freedom to pile on veggies to your heart’s content. The atmosphere buzzes with the energy of a well-run team, highlighted by attentive and friendly staff who clearly take pride in both their craft and customer service.

One of the standout offerings on their menu is the Sweet Heat Large Pizza, inspired by Marvel Television’s Daredevil Born Again. This daring pie combines a perfectly crisp crust with a fiery red sauce, double pepperoni, and fresh mozzarella, delivering a smoky, spicy kick that excites the palate. For a lighter, yet equally flavorful choice, the Green Goddess Chop Salad is a must-try, featuring crisp romaine, juicy tomatoes, mushrooms, black olives, and shredded mozzarella all tossed in a luscious creamy pesto-ranch dressing that dances on your taste buds.

If you're looking for something comforting, the Fast Fire’d Meatballs Side is a delectable treat packed with juicy pork and beef blend meatballs swimming in housemade red sauce, enriched with ricotta and topped with tangy banana peppers or a spicy jalapeno kick. The blend of textures and bold flavors truly delivers a satisfying experience.

Fast, Easy Pizza with Gluten Free / Vegan options! I tried the gluten free crust which is also vegan with vegan cheese and other toppings. The crust was super thin like a cracker. The red sauce was good as well. The pizza cooked in just a few minutes so it’s good for a quick meal. I could definitely see myself going back.

The food here is good. There’s lots of topping options as well as vegan and gluten free crusts. Their crust is pretty thin, so if you don’t like that, I suggest the high rise crust (for a $3 upcharge). I also recommend the cinnamon bread. As for service, there are plenty of people that stick out to me such as Makayla, Jacob, and Abbie. They’re always super nice and friendly. The atmosphere is good, kind of an industrial vibe. There’s both seats and booths available. The lighting is a little dark, but I kind of feel like it adds something to the place. There is also outdoor seating.
